Hello everyone,

I would like to draw my own section line as a block.

Section line letters will be entered as follow:

1) the first one as an attribute value;

2) the second one as copy of value of the first one, but in text format.

Is it possible?

I try to create a Text - Right Click - Field Insert - Object - Select Object - Select Properties (Attribute Value) - OK, but it doesn't work. Showed text is always ---.

Attached you can find what I try to do.

Thank you for sharing the file. It looks like your attribute only has a tag and prompt value, the default, or actual, value is blank. 

 

Capture.JPG 

 

When I added a value for Default, it updated in your field. I hope that helps.
